How to use the #197670 color code in HTML & CSS?
To apply the hex color #197670 in web design, set the color property inside your CSS stylesheet. For example, adding background-color: #197670; will paint elements in this cool undertone shade. In modern CSS structures, you can configure it as a custom variable --color-hex: #197670; or utilize it directly in Tailwind CSS via arbitrary utility values like bg-[#197670].
What are the RGB and HSL conversion values for #197670?
In the digital sRGB color space, the hex value #197670 is converted to RGB values of Red: 25, Green: 118, and Blue: 112. When analyzed under the HSL model, its coordinates correspond to hue angle 176°, 65% saturation, and 28% lightness. This makes it visually a dark, rich color with a balanced, moderate saturation.
CMYK print code settings for #197670
When converting #197670 for CMYK printing, the color separation consists of 79% Cyan, 0% Magenta, 5% Yellow, and 54% key/black. These neutral color boundaries serve as solid structural backgrounds, layouts, and typography grids.
